James Avery is in conversation with Retail Media Network Consultant, Sam Wright. Previously at Klarna, Sam led the team that successfully built Klarna Media from the ground up.

He shares a simple truth: businesses with revenues in the low millions are successfully launching retail media networks alongside companies doing billions.

The real question isn't about size. It's about having:
▪️ A solid core business
▪️ Clear demand from brands wanting to reach your customers
▪️ A way to deliver measurable results

Most retailers already see the signs. Brands are asking for more ways to connect with your audience. They want better attribution. They want to move beyond vague trade dollars into trackable performance.

The headroom varies by business, but the opportunity is real across the board.

Sam's advice? Start by looking at what brands are already asking you for. If there's pull in the market, you have what you need to begin.

The rules of retail media have changed and Matthew Nichols from Commerce Ventures has watched the shift firsthand. What started as a simple choice — build like Amazon or fully outsource — has become far more complex.

In our latest episode, Matt breaks down five forces reshaping the industry:

🎧 AI is killing keyword targeting. Large language models now identify product associations humans never could, shifting advertising from search terms to outcomes.
🎧 ChatGPT could become the next Shopify.
Interactive AI platforms let consumers ask questions, compare options, and buy, all without leaving the experience.
🎧 Lean supply chains are winning.
Companies like Shein prove keeping products close to manufacturers beats pushing inventory to consumers.
🎧 Marketplaces drive ad revenue.
More third-party products mean more competition and more sponsored placements.
🎧 Full outsourcing is dead.
Retail media is too valuable to hand off completely, but building everything in-house isn't realistic either.
